Definition

A dominator is a person, group, or thing that has power over others and controls or rules them.

Usage & Nuances

Mostly used in formal, academic, or technical contexts, often referring to social, psychological, or competitive power dynamics. Less common in everyday conversation. Can have a negative connotation, implying someone acts aggressively to stay in control.
